Skip to content

Commit

Permalink
chore(deps): split linux and windows requirements.txt
Browse files Browse the repository at this point in the history
markuslf committed Jan 25, 2025
1 parent 8c902dd commit cd7aada
Showing 4 changed files with 825 additions and 47 deletions.
22 changes: 22 additions & 0 deletions requirements-windows.in
Original file line number Diff line number Diff line change
@@ -0,0 +1,22 @@
# python3.9 -m pip install --user --upgrade pip
# python3.9 -m pip install --user pip-tools
# python3.9 -m piptools compile --generate-hashes requirements.in

beautifulsoup4
flatdict
lxml --only-binary=lxml
netifaces
psutil
pymysql
PySmbClient
python-novaclient
python-swiftclient
pywinrm
pyyaml
requests
smbprotocol
vici
xmltodict

# needed on Windows:
sspilib
797 changes: 797 additions & 0 deletions requirements-windows.txt

Large diffs are not rendered by default.

3 changes: 0 additions & 3 deletions requirements.in
Original file line number Diff line number Diff line change
@@ -17,6 +17,3 @@ requests
smbprotocol
vici
xmltodict

# needed on Windows:
sspilib
50 changes: 6 additions & 44 deletions requirements.txt
Original file line number Diff line number Diff line change
@@ -506,9 +506,9 @@ pbr==6.1.0 \
# oslo-serialization
# python-novaclient
# stevedore
prettytable==3.12.0 \
--hash=sha256:77ca0ad1c435b6e363d7e8623d7cc4fcf2cf15513bf77a1c1b2e814930ac57cc \
--hash=sha256:f04b3e1ba35747ac86e96ec33e3bb9748ce08e254dc2a1c6253945901beec804
prettytable==3.13.0 \
--hash=sha256:30e1a097a7acb075b5c488ffe01195349b37009c2d43ca7fa8b5f6a61daace5b \
--hash=sha256:d4f5817a248b77ddaa25b27007566c0a6a064308d991516b61b436ffdbb4f8e9
# via python-novaclient
psutil==6.1.1 \
--hash=sha256:018aeae2af92d943fdf1da6b58665124897cfc94faa2ca92098838f83e1b1bca \
@@ -642,44 +642,6 @@ soupsieve==2.6 \
--hash=sha256:e2e68417777af359ec65daac1057404a3c8a5455bb8abc36f1a9866ab1a51abb \
--hash=sha256:e72c4ff06e4fb6e4b5a9f0f55fe6e81514581fca1515028625d0f299c602ccc9
# via beautifulsoup4
sspilib==0.2.0 \
--hash=sha256:0216344629b0f39c2193adb74d7e1bed67f1bbd619e426040674b7629407eba9 \
--hash=sha256:02d8e0b6033de8ccf509ba44fdcda7e196cdedc0f8cf19eb22c5e4117187c82f \
--hash=sha256:1208720d8e431af674c5645cec365224d035f241444d5faa15dc74023ece1277 \
--hash=sha256:1a6c33495a3de1552120c4a99219ebdd70e3849717867b8cae3a6a2f98fef405 \
--hash=sha256:1c5f84b9f614447fc451620c5c44001ed48fead3084c7c9f2b9cefe1f4c5c3d0 \
--hash=sha256:32422ad7406adece12d7c385019b34e3e35ff88a7c8f3d7c062da421772e7bfa \
--hash=sha256:34f566ba8b332c91594e21a71200de2d4ce55ca5a205541d4128ed23e3c98777 \
--hash=sha256:3e82f87d77a9da62ce1eac22f752511a99495840177714c772a9d27b75220f78 \
--hash=sha256:400d5922c2c2261009921157c4b43d868e84640ad86e4dc84c95b07e5cc38ac6 \
--hash=sha256:404c16e698476e500a7fe67be5457fadd52d8bdc9aeb6c554782c8f366cc4fc9 \
--hash=sha256:40a97ca83e503a175d1dc9461836994e47e8b9bcf56cab81a2c22e27f1993079 \
--hash=sha256:40ff410b64198cf1d704718754fc5fe7b9609e0c49bf85c970f64c6fc2786db4 \
--hash=sha256:4d6cd4290ca82f40705efeb5e9107f7abcd5e647cb201a3d04371305938615b8 \
--hash=sha256:5b11e4f030de5c5de0f29bcf41a6e87c9fd90cb3b0f64e446a6e1d1aef4d08f5 \
--hash=sha256:6944a0d7fe64f88c9bde3498591acdb25b178902287919b962c398ed145f71b9 \
--hash=sha256:6fa9d97671348b97567020d82fe36c4211a2cacf02abbccbd8995afbf3a40bfc \
--hash=sha256:850a17c98d2b8579b183ce37a8df97d050bc5b31ab13f5a6d9e39c9692fe3754 \
--hash=sha256:863b7b214517b09367511c0ef931370f0386ed2c7c5613092bf9b106114c4a0e \
--hash=sha256:8697e5dd9229cd3367bca49fba74e02f867759d1d416a717e26c3088041b9814 \
--hash=sha256:8ffc09819a37005c66a580ff44f544775f9745d5ed1ceeb37df4e5ff128adf36 \
--hash=sha256:9460258d3dc3f71cc4dcfd6ac078e2fe26f272faea907384b7dd52cb91d9ddcc \
--hash=sha256:a0ede7afba32f2b681196c0b8520617d99dc5d0691d04884d59b476e31b41286 \
--hash=sha256:a4d788a53b8db6d1caafba36887d5ac2087e6b6be6f01eb48f8afea6b646dbb5 \
--hash=sha256:abac93a90335590b49ef1fc162b538576249c7f58aec0c7bcfb4b860513979b4 \
--hash=sha256:ad7943fe14f8f6d72623ab6401991aa39a2b597bdb25e531741b37932402480f \
--hash=sha256:b290eb90bf8b8136b0a61b189629442052e1a664bd78db82928ec1e81b681fb5 \
--hash=sha256:b9044d6020aa88d512e7557694fe734a243801f9a6874e1c214451eebe493d92 \
--hash=sha256:bd95df50efb6586054963950c8fa91ef994fb73c5c022c6f85b16f702c5314da \
--hash=sha256:bdf9a4f424add02951e1f01f47441d2e69a9910471e99c2c88660bd8e184d7f8 \
--hash=sha256:c39a698491f43618efca8776a40fb7201d08c415c507f899f0df5ada15abefaa \
--hash=sha256:d1cdfc5ec2f151f26e21aa50ccc7f9848c969d6f78264ae4f38347609f6722df \
--hash=sha256:d3e7d19c16ba9189ef8687b591503db06cfb9c5eb32ab1ca3bb9ebc1a8a5f35c \
--hash=sha256:e0943204c8ba732966fdc5b69e33cf61d8dc6b24e6ed875f32055d9d7e2f76cd \
--hash=sha256:e436fa09bcf353a364a74b3ef6910d936fa8cd1493f136e517a9a7e11b319c57 \
--hash=sha256:e48dceb871ecf9cf83abdd0e6db5326e885e574f1897f6ae87d736ff558f4bfa \
--hash=sha256:f65c52ead8ce95eb78a79306fe4269ee572ef3e4dcc108d250d5933da2455ecc
# via -r requirements.in
stevedore==5.4.0 \
--hash=sha256:79e92235ecb828fe952b6b8b0c6c87863248631922c8e8e0fa5b17b232c4514d \
--hash=sha256:b0be3c4748b3ea7b854b265dcb4caa891015e442416422be16f8b31756107857
@@ -690,9 +652,9 @@ typing-extensions==4.12.2 \
--hash=sha256:04e5ca0351e0f3f85c6853954072df659d0d13fac324d0072316b67d7794700d \
--hash=sha256:1a7ead55c7e559dd4dee8856e3a88b41225abfe1ce8df57b7c13915fe121ffb8
# via keystoneauth1
tzdata==2024.2 \
--hash=sha256:7d85cc416e9382e69095b7bdf4afd9e3880418a2413feec7069d533d6b4e31cc \
--hash=sha256:a48093786cdcde33cad18c2555e8532f34422074448fbc874186f0abd79565cd
tzdata==2025.1 \
--hash=sha256:24894909e88cdb28bd1636c6887801df64cb485bd593f2fd83ef29075a81d694 \
--hash=sha256:7e127113816800496f027041c570f50bcd464a020098a3b6b199517772303639
# via
# oslo-serialization
# oslo-utils

0 comments on commit cd7aada

Please sign in to comment.